Ukrainian economy lost 20.4% of GDP due to war in Donbas last year

The economy of Ukraine lost 20.4% of GDP as a result of the war in Donbas in 2016.

This is stated in the Global Peace Index report, published by the Institute for Economics and Peace in Sydney, Australia.

According to the Institute, Ukraine lost 20.4% of GDP or USD 66.7 billion in purchasing power as a result of military hostilities in Donbas last year.

Thus, Ukraine ranks 19th in economic losses as a result of the armed conflicts. Syria suffered the greatest losses from the war. Switzerland takes the last place. Russia ranks 31st.

In addition, Ukraine took 154th place in the peacefulness ranking. Ukraine went up by two points but still remained among the low peace countries, including the Central African Republic, the Democratic Republic of the Congo, Pakistan, North Korea and Russia. Iceland was recognized to be the most peaceful country in the world.
